Description

The Psychology of Religion by Vassilis Saroglou explores the complex relationships between religion, morality, and human behavior. This thought-provoking book examines the factors that influence religiosity, including genetics, environment, personality, cognition, and emotion. Saroglou presents a balanced view of the psychological costs and benefits associated with both religious and atheistic beliefs, highlighting how certain aspects of each can become more significant in specific contexts. By analyzing the effects of religion on health, social behavior, and morality, the book sheds light on the enduring role of faith in modern society. A comprehensive and engaging study, The Psychology of Religion offers a nuanced understanding of the intricate dynamics at play when it comes to human spirituality and belief systems.
